How to ripen avocados naturally?
The best way to harness nature’s methods of ripening is to put your avocado in a paper or cloth (not plastic) bag with a banana, which gives off high levels of ethylene, and leave for two to three days to ripen (really rock hard ones will take up to four or five days to ripen) – the bag will concentrate the gas.

How much does an avocado weigh without the pit?
The average California avocado, as represented by the Fuerte and Hass varieties, weighs 7.6 ounces (215 grams). The edible portion of this “average” avocado weighs 5.4 ounces (153 grams). A typical serving of one-half avocado weighs 2.7 ounces (77 grams).
Can you eat an avocado with black spots?
An avocado that’s ready to eat has light green flesh. A rotten one has brown or black spots throughout the flesh (2). Yet, an isolated brown spot may be due to bruising, rather than widespread spoilage, and can be cut away. … If the fruit looks good otherwise and doesn’t taste off, it’s fine to eat.
Why do avocado trees drop their fruit?
An avocado tree will typically drop some of its unripe fruit in the summer simply because it has grown more fruit than the tree can reasonably support. This is normal and allows your tree to better support and develop the remaining fruit. Regular thinning of fruit can often help alleviate this.

How do you stop an avocado from browning?
After brushing with the oil, store the avocado in an airtight container in the fridge. You can also brush your avocado’s flesh with lemon juice—the citric acid in the lemon juice dramatically slows the browning process. Again, store in an airtight container for extra protection.
How to slice a avocado?
Using a sharp chef’s knife, slice through the avocado lengthwise until you feel the knife hit the pit. Then rotate the avocado, keeping the knife steady, to make a cut all around the pit. Twist the two halves apart. Tip: It’s safest to do this on a cutting board.

How to raise an avocado tree?
Water deeply and regularly; let the tree dry out slightly before watering again. To conserve moisture, mulch trees with 3 or 4 inches of coarse wood chips. Always leave several inches between the mulch and tree trunk. Some experts don’t recommend fertilizing avocado trees the first year.

Can bunnies eat avocado skin?
Can my rabbit have avocado skin? No. Avocado skin is highly toxic to rabbits as it contains a high concentration of the toxin persin.
